Powder Coating: A Solvent-Free, Sustainable Option

Powder coating is an eco-friendly surface treatment option that does away with solvents, lowering VOC emissions and hazardous waste. This dry finishing process offers the best durability, efficiency, and eco-friendliness to the metal furniture-making industry.

Zero VOC Emissions

Unlike solvent based coatings, powder coatings are free of volatile organic compounds (VOC), thus a much cleaner and safer solution for both the workers and the environment.

Exceptional Durability

Powder coated surfaces are resistant to scratches, corrosion, chipping and fading, thereby providing durable protection to the metal furniture in both indoor and outdoor environments.

Efficient Material Usage

The electrostatic application process increases efficiency because waste is minimized as extra powder can be gathered and reused thus helping in saving on materials and deg radiation to the environment.

No Hazardous Waste

Since the powder coatings are free from solvents and heavy metals, they produce less toxic effluent, thus, latter disposal becomes safer and environmentally friendly.

Lower Energy Consumption

Several types of powder coatings cure at lower temperatures than traditional choices, involving less energy. This decrease in energy consumption contributes to a decrease in carbon footprint during the production process as well.

Nanotechnology in Eco-Friendly Metal Finishes

Nanotechnology is changing metal furnishing coatings by making them more durable, corrosion resistant, and self-cleansifying. These extremely thin coatings offer top-level protection and are without poisonous chemicals and untold maintenance.

Enhanced Corrosion Resistance

Nano-coatings establish a molecular barrier that stops rust and oxidation. This extra protection greatly enhances the lifespan of metal furniture so it endures long term.

Self-Cleaning Properties

Hydrophobic nanocoatings show water-repellency and are resistant toward dust and dirt, leading to cleaner surfaces coming less frequently and instead with the use of chemicals for maintenance.

Anti-Microbial Protection

Some nanocoatings are developed with antimicrobial substances to stop the development of adverse bacteria and mold on metal, to be utilized primarily in public and healthcare areas.

Ultra-Thin and Transparent

Different from traditional coating, nanocoating is almost invisible and keeps the original appearance of metal furniture with advanced protection performance.

Eco-Friendly and Non-Toxic

Many nanocoatings are also water-based with no damaging solvents. By removing these toxins, they decrease VOC emissions and downright decrease the environmental aggressiveness.

Increased Wear and Scratch Resistance

Nanoparticles boost the surface hardness, which converts metal furniture to become scratch resistant, abrasion, and resistant to daily tearing and repair.
